Dubai to create 40,000 jobs by 2030 with Metaverse push

image of woman using VR headset

What

Prince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ed has set out metaverse expansion plans for Dubai

Why

The expansion is predicted to generate an additional $4 billion for Dubai’s economy and make it a top 10 hub for metaverse talent

What next

Over the next eight years, Dubai will seek to recruit 40,000 remote workers to help build the metaverse

The story

According to a press release covering the announcement, recruitment efforts will focus on developing aug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R) technology. In addition, 5G networks will be adapted to make the metaverse accessible on the go and to a wider audience.

Hamdan bin Mohammed said that “The metaverse is a promising digital world. We aim to harness this technology to enhance the quality of life in the UAE and across the globe,” 

The prince also announced a new event called the “Dubai Metaverse Assembly” which will aim to bring metaverse experts together to “educate, inspire, contribute” to the metaverse.
